Did you know that Jabu “Shuffle” Mahlangu (Pule) didn’t have a jersey when he made his debut for Kaizer Chiefs?
Shuffle was with the Amakhosi reserves when he got the call to join up with the first team for the second match of the Vodacom Challenge back in 1999.
He was handed the famous No.11 jersey worn by the great Teenage Dladla by the kitman, but it was printed with the name Moosa because it was meant to be worn by Zane Moosa.
But Moosa was on his way out of the club and the
kitman put a white plaster over Moosa’s name and wrote Jabu with a black marker.
The rest as they say is history.
